Description

Sitting on a 1 acre plot in the sought after village of Seer Green. An impressive family home with generous accommodation in excess of 9000 sq.ft. This significant modern mansion was designed and built by Meryl Homes in 2003 with its luxurious specification including concrete floors to the ground and first floor. All the principal rooms have wiring for a multi-room audio system. Bathrooms have Villeroy & Boch fittings and there are handmade fitted wardrobes in most bedrooms. The welcoming interiors have been recently enhanced by a locally based interior design company. The generous reception hall offers a central curving oak staircase, flanked by a generous drawing room with central stone fireplace and a separate dining room. To the rear of the house, is the kitchen/breakfast room, opening through double doors into the family room. Practical use has been made of the back door area, which has a boot room for coats and shoes, whilst keeping the adjacent utility area separate. The guests cloakroom has generous coats cupboards. A further sitting room with bar area, conservatory and study complete the generous and versatile six reception rooms. A stunning staircase sweeps upwards to the first floor with a galleried landing providing access to five first floor bedrooms all with their own en suite bathrooms and built in wardrobes as well as a the large south facing balcony. The significant principal bedroom suite occupies the whole of the right hand wing, with a large dressing room with considerable wardrobe space and a beautiful en suite bathroom. A self-contained staircase leads to the 2nd floor and Bedroom 6 with an en suite shower room and walk in storage rooms. The present owners are currently using this considerable space as a wonderful games area with space for a cinema, snooker table and table football. Outside The gardens and semi-rural setting are a feature of the house, which is well set back from Long Bottom Lane. Occupying a plot of 1 acre, the house is approached by a sweeping driveway via a pair of wrought iron gates. The driveway affords ample parking for a number of vehicles and is supported by a double garage which is also double length. Stairs rise from the garage to a spacious attic room which has potential to be converted into a self-contained annex/ staff accommodation subject to the usual permissions. The front garden is laid to lawn with attractive feature planting enhancing the house in its setting. To the rear of the house is the entertaining terrace and pond, rising through lawned terracing to private woodland. Situation The house is situated on Long Bottom Lane in the popular village of Seer Green providing convenient access to the local shops, Seer Green railway station, sought after primary school and amenities of the village. Easy transport links to London are available at Seer Green railway station located a short walk of less than half a mile away which offers a direct link on the Chiltern Line to London Marylebone (fastest train approximately 26 minutes). Beaconsfield New Town is approximately two miles away with its array of shops and supermarkets.
